Responsibilities For Engineering Program Manager- Home Team Product Design

  • Support product definition and drive closure of architecture and technical opens in early stages of projects
  • Establish and manage program feature baseline, scheduling, budget, critical paths, and technology risk areas
  • Identify and highlight technical risk areas and mitigation strategies
  • Drive drawing releases and tooling kickoff with PD Engineering and vendors
  • Plan and execute prototype builds by directing OEM partners
  • Lead cross functional communication between project teams and external vendors
  • Drive day-to-day activities to meet overall project objectives
  • Provide status updates across multiple levels of organization

Requirements For Engineering Program Manager- Home Team Product Design

  • BS Degree
  • 3+ years experience leading program management or mechanical engineering design of product development
  • Excellent communication, organizational, presentation and leadership skills
  • Self motivated and proactive with demonstrated creative and critical thinking capabilities
  • Ability to handle rapid development cycles and remain flexible with changes
  • Knowledge of product development processes and manufacturing processes
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to manage complex design strategies
  • Experience with cross functional teams
